A1: Yes, flak turrets will take up turret mounts on Capital ships, so you'll have to choose wisely how many defensive vs offensive weapons you mount on your ships to best suit their purpose. If your ship is intended to defend or escort a group of cargo ships, you might then prefer to have mostly flak cannons, with a gun or two to take out any slow attacking ships, while a ship designed for destroying a Station might be exclusively offensive-armed. The choice of loadouts is yours, the turret limit is on the engine, so choose the turrets you have well. Q2: Will the styles of ships ever be unified? A2: Nope. To each faction goes their own design style. There isn't a RoVerse-standard style, as that'd be quite boring and constrictive. Instead, we encourage our factions to find their own style and stick with it, so their ships can be recognized anywhere, either for their reliability, or for their destructive power. On the development side this week, Idyllic took aim at a few bugs that have been plaguing the dogfight. First up is a small fix to spawn location selection - the original code specifically picks a spawn location from exactly 8 options in a folder in the map. No more, no less. This has caused issues a few times in the past, where a spawn location would be missing and the game would come screeching to a halt. Now, with the help of a small addition to the code, it selects a random location from any number of locations in that folder, not just 8. Also, a bit of variance has been added to the location, spreading it out from a single point. No more spawning inside someone else who just respawned! This also provides the added benefit that spawns can be dynamically added and removed while a round is active, which will be important when you can respawn on friendly capitals. Next up was a look into outpost clipping issues, where two or more modules would clip through each other during generation, causing turrets to be inside other modules and unreachable. Idyllic dove into the code, tweaked a few variables, and modified a few module hitboxes, and ran quite a few large-scale tests to make sure that there were no more issues. Last up is a patch to filter sorting, where a table was being shallow-copied and editing the list of all light fighters, for example, to include other filter selections, which led to a severe breakdown in the filtering abilities. Now that the 10 lines of code deep-copy a table, filters should be working correctly in the beta. We hope everyone is having a wonderful Christmas, and we wish you a happy new year as well. This week, before the holidays set in, Idyllic worked on refining the dodge mechanics we revealed last week, and we've made a few changes to how they work. Now that we've had a chance to test the dodge with a wider variety of ships, a few changes were clearly necessary. For larger ships, the agile and quick sideways dodge just wasn't the right fit, as was immediately demonstrated by Fang and his Kazan. Big ships with slow speeds just look ridiculous twirling around in space all graceful like, and that won't do, no matter how hilarious it is to see. Now, the ship's agility stat is used to determine the roll speed, preventing such wild flailing around, while keeping light fighters quick and nimble. You may also notice that it only completes one revolution. Under a certain threshold, double-roll dodges would take upwards of 15 seconds to complete, which didn't seem in the spirit of things. So they keep their slow roll, but only roll over once, and don't go nearly as far laterally, to make up for their low agility. We also made a few changes to controls. We're going to be testing out moving the dodge keys to Q and E and see how that performs in combat, since the roll keys are prone to be tapped more often. Also, the loop-the-loop dodge has been replaced by a 180, and moved to the X key, so double-tap that to turn around. This week, Idyllic continued on their experimentation kick, ticking off another long-time feature request. Available now for testing in the dogfight are new dodge mechanics. Double-tapping left or right will make your ship dodge left or right, and double-tapping s will make you do a loop. Try these new evasive maneuvers in combat and see how they change your fighting style. The first iteration just applied an aggressive roll to your ship, spinning you and your camera around violently. This would've made everyone quite nauseous, so we attempted to counter that roll with an opposite and equal camera roll - making sure it was equal was the difficult part, as seen above. And below... But once we got the balance down, things were smooth sailing. Dodging also uses up a small amount of boost energy, so that you can't just spam dodges nonstop while boosting away from someone, so use your extra maneuverability thrust wisely. Be sure to let us know how it works, and if you'd like any changes. We can adjust the trigger time, if you normally double-tap A and D in other scenarios where you don't want to dodge. And we're not sold on the double roll vs a single roll, so let us know if you think it's too long of an animation. And while we were at it, messing around with ship movement code, we also took a stab at a long-term feature we've promised - Engine Kill: There remains a problem with the location the camera locks in on when triggered that we'll be fixing, but the mechanics are there. The ship maintains its current vector and speed, can't accelerate or boost but can slow down and strafe. You'll be able to cruise past someone, turn and fire your weapons without losing your present direction in style. This should revolutionize the Gatecrash gamemode, since you'll be able to fight back against someone on your tail. We look forward to seeing it in use. After the successful inclusion of 28 ship shields, Idyllic doubled down and set a task of creating shields for every last ship included in the dogfight. While blender may have complained about it, and there may have been some long not responding delays, 101 more ships were meshed, nearly entirely at the same time. After many crashes and a lot of RAM issues, the whole fleet has been successfully meshed. Bulk imports respecting UV maps was fixed, and a custom solution to modifying specialmesh offsets was developed. A terribly glitchy fork of SBS was made, that instead of moving parts, moves the offset value of the mesh. It's also so broken that it doesn't work when reopening a place, and has to be re-exported as a local plugin. We made a few touchups to missile raycasting, so that their explosions occur closer to where the rockets appear to be. This will change the feel of torpedoes a bit, but those are mostly only useful on Outpost Turrets, and the community has just proven how deadly non-missile weaponry can be. Previously, the rocket visuals would trail the raycast by an entire step, and due to its acceleration over time, the lengthening raycast made the rocket fall further and further behind. Now, it should stay relatively close to the front of the raycast, and keeping the rocket closer to the explosion site. However, this may lead to situations where the rocket passes through something that hasn't been hit by the raycast, but that is just a sacrifice we'll have to make. This week, with Roblox back in working order, we can now return to your regularly scheduled programming. While the servers were down, Idyllic took the opportunity to dive into making ship shields. Since that all takes place in blender, and we had luckily pre-exported a selection of ship models, we had everything we needed on-hand. Our prior proof-of-concept method for making ship shields involved painstakingly tracing out a low-res outline of each ship, which with an ever-increasing number of submissions and additions, was infeasible. So with the encouragement of the community, Idyllic explored alternative options for automating the process, as well as re-exploring some ideas that didn't work when we initially prototyped the system, but that miraculously work now. Our original prototype shield simply scaled up the Excalibur mesh and replaced the texture, but unfortunately not every ship is nearly as convex. Ships that have protrusions or bends will not scale correctly, as a proper shield is offset from each surface's normal, not scaled from model center. So this required revisiting the drawing board. For the Avenger, recreating the shield was a simple enough task - just match the angles and go around some weird corners, and it works passably well. But this would not be nearly as easy when asymmetry became involved, or very complex shapes. The first one to really give us trouble was the Blue Komodo, a particularly round ship that was going to be a right pain to mesh. So we re-explored Blender Modifiers. The first time around, Solidify-Remesh-Decimate produced quite terrible results. They were often collapsed in the wrong place, or triangulated on angled surfaces, and were going to be just as much work as doing them all by hand. However, since our original experiments, Blender 2.9 has been released, and it has added a new setting to the Remesh Modifier - Voxel. This setting, combined with an extremely aggressive Decimate modifier to cut the number of faces down from the millions, provide a nearly-perfect shell of just about any ship. And so, Idyllic set to work refining the process. Prebuilding the Modifier settings, figuring out the best order to apply modifiers in, and figuring out how to fix any irregularities without killing Blender. With the process complete, it was time to make the shields of the somewhat random selection of ships available. 28 ship shields so far, have been imported and attached to their host. There are, however, a few remaining problems. Bulk-importing the meshes from a single .obj file breaks the UV maps of each ship, making it so that the shield doesn't do the shield effect, which is the entire point, so each ship has to be exported individually. But this does give us the opportunity to name the mesh correctly, so it can easily be associated with the right ship. We can still bulk import the meshes, but by selecting multiple files. But the results speak for themselves - we can't wait to see all the ships in-game with such fancy shield-damage effects.
